I have received 3 sensors, and set them up to compare to my Lab reference PT100. Found differences in resistance about 2.4 Ohms. And this translates to about 8 deg. of C - shift to the lower temperature. If using this sensor "as is" measured temperature of 21 deg. of C will be seen as 13 deg of C. (This problem also was reported by: tioted in 2015-07-29) To correct the problem, I have connected 2.4 Ohm 1% Metal Film resistor in series with the sensor. This corrected the problem but introduced some 2% of non linearity - which in most circuits is acceptable. If you are using MCU with PT100 Table in the memory, you can introduce the correction table, and solve the problem without any additional resistors - the elegant solution. This sensor price is 1/10 of the "perfect PT100" for the above reason of - it needs a little correction. Thanks Banggood.
